What's The Definition Of Warmness?
[n] the quality of having a moderate degree of heat; "an agreeable warmth in the house"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Warmness: warmth Related Terms | Find terms related to Warmness: See Also | heat | high temperature | hotness | lukewarmness | tepidity | tepidness Warmness In Webster's Dictionary \Warm"ness\, n.
Warmth. --Chaucer.
